A door control unit is a powerful tool that allows users to control who enters and exits a building or room. It consists of a variety of components such as electronic locks, keypads, card readers, biometric scanners, and control panels. These components work together to regulate access to a specific area based on predetermined rules and permissions set by the system administrator.

One of the main benefits of a door control unit is its ability to restrict access to authorized personnel only. This means that individuals without the proper credentials cannot enter the designated area, helping to prevent theft, vandalism, or unauthorized entry. By using electronic keys, access cards, or biometric data, the system ensures that only approved individuals can gain entry, creating a secure environment for employees, customers, or residents.

Furthermore, a door control unit offers real-time monitoring and access control capabilities. Through the use of centralized software, system administrators can track who enters and exits the premises, as well as when and where they accessed the area. This data can be invaluable in the event of a security breach or incident, as it provides a clear record of activity for investigation purposes.

Moreover, a door control unit can be integrated with other security systems, such as surveillance cameras or alarm systems, to provide a comprehensive security solution. By connecting these systems, users can receive alerts and notifications in real-time, allowing them to respond quickly to potential security threats. This seamless integration ensures that the entire security infrastructure works together cohesively to protect the premises.
